It&#8217;s not an easy thing to put a label on the the songs of Marissa Nadler.\u00a0 If I had to describe them with words, I would have to say that they are powerful pieces of music that are melancholy, gothic, psychedelic, folksy, dreamy, spacey, and sometimes unsettling.\u00a0 With a voice that is as delicate as a flower yet haunting enough to make you sleep with one eye opened, Marissa Nadler has carved her own place in music defying any kind of genre or tag.<\/p>\n<p>The song &#8220;If I Could Breathe Underwater&#8221; was co-written with one of Marissa&#8217;s longtime friends, Mary Lattimore.\u00a0 Marissa had this to say about the song:<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When I wrote \u2018If I Could Breathe Underwater,\u2019 I was contemplating the possibilities of possessing various superhuman powers: teleportation, shapeshifting, energy projection,<br \/>\naquatic breathing, extrasensory perception, and time travel to name a few,\u201d says Nadler. \u201cAs a lyrical device, I married those powers with events in my life, wondering if and how they could<br \/>\nchange the past or predict the future. I loved working on the melody for this song and bringing the choruses to their climaxes. Mary\u2019s layered, hallucinatory shimmers really echo the netherworld of the story.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The accompanying video, beautifully directed and edited by Jenni Hensler with cinematography by Nick Fancher, serves to create a preternatural world where Nadler changes the colors of the sky and the water, floats weightlessly through seas, and becomes one with layers of color and ink. It was shot on 16mm film (with the exception of the underwater shots). \u201cThis song took on many meanings to me and I love that about it. How beauty and tragedy collide,\u201d says Hensler. \u201cDreaming of having supernatural powers to change reality and have the ability to live and breathe underwater. It could also speak to the duality of existence. That we all have inner personas or shadow selves, and how we envision those different masks we wear. I chose to make something that touched on the idea of duality and the inner persona.
